ARCHBOLD CNA TRAINING PROGRAM

The next program start date is May 2023.

Archbold Medical Center has partnered with Southern Regional Technical College (SRTC) to increase the number of certified nursing assistants (CNAs) in our system. SRTC will provide coursework as well as clinical hours required for the program. This program also includes Certified Medication Assistant training. SRTC will assist the students with required onsite testing once the program is complete.

Two (2) five-week courses will be taught each semester with a total of fourteen students per class. Students that participate in the five-week training program will be hired as Archbold employees while earning CNA credit hours.

  • Students that are selected will receive $2,700 in scholarship funds, which will include the CNA program, books and materials, scrubs and testing fees.
  • Students will earn an hourly wage while completing 150 hours of coursework and clinical hours.
  • Students will be required to work up to 4 hours per week at Archbold to meet apprenticeship requirements.
  • Students will be required to sign a contract stating they will work for the organization for two years after certification is obtained.
  • All CNA requirements outlined by the State of Georgia will be followed.
  • Upon program completion, graduates will be eligible to take the CNA certification exam to become a Certified Nursing Assistant. Once the student is certified, they will be placed at an Archbold Long-Term Care Facility. The pay rate will be increased to CNA pay. If the student does not pass, they will work at one of Archbold’s acute care facilities until licensure is obtained.
  • CNAs, employed by Archbold, depending on the facility where they are placed, will work 12-hour shifts, day or night, any day of the week, including weekends and holidays.

Experience /Qualifications


Archbold will screen all applicants following standard employment practices, including a face-to-face interview with program staff and the Archbold Human Resources department. In addition, candidates must also meet all of the following requirements:

  • High School Diploma or GED required
  • Must be able to pass reading/math skill assessments
  • Cannot be enrolled in any other college courses during the program
  • Must have a clear background
  • Must pass employment physical and drug screen
